A Pilates-inspired class with a blend of postnatal-specific movement and low-impact strength training. Mat-based exercises using body weight, bands, balls, circles, reformer, and light weights. Focus on posture, mobility, core engagement, and technique. Ideal for mums seeking gentle yet effective full-body conditioning.
A mat-based, Pilates-inspired class focusing on core control, mobility, breathwork, and gentle pelvic floor activation. This class is ideal for women seeking a calm, low-impact movement style that still delivers effective support for pregnancy and birth preparation.
A restorative yet challenging class blending traditional Pilates principles with functional strength and mobility training. With a focus on posture, core stability, and mindful movement, it's ideal for mums looking to rebuild strength, improve flexibility, and enhance body awareness post-pregnancy.
